What makes a sibling set work

The names people regret are the ones that rhyme, start with the same letter, or sit far apart in popularity. A good match for Oliver avoids all three. Oliver with Theodore or Evelyn does that.

Should a sibling name match Oliver?

It should feel like it belongs to the same family as Oliver, not like a matching set. That means a shared era or style — Oliver reads as vintage and classic, so lean that way — but a different starting sound and ending. Names that rhyme with Oliver or also start with "O" get fewer points here.

Does Oliver need a sibling name of the same origin?

It helps but is not required. Another Latin name (like Oliver) gets a small scoring bonus because shared roots read as deliberate, but a strong style match with Oliver matters more either way.

How is the match score for Oliver worked out?

Each name is checked against Oliver: a shared style and era counts the most, then how close the two are in popularity, then points come off for rhyming with Oliver, sharing its "O" start, or ending on the same sound. Full detail on the NamePairings how-we-score page.
